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

Frequently asked questions

What is 02818- Corona, Ca's energy grade?

02818- Corona, Ca scores 68 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band C (Below median (55–69)) — in its 2021 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does 02818- Corona, Ca use?

Its 2021 site energy-use intensity was 213.1 kBtu/ft² across 50,078 sq ft, including 1,838,911 kWh of electricity and 41,652 therms of natural gas.
